What Are Garage Door Cables?
Garage door cables are strong, flexible wires that work in tandem with the springs to lift and lower the garage door. They are typically made of stainless steel or galvanized wire, ensuring durability and strength. These cables bear the weight of the garage door, making it possible to open and close the door smoothly and safely.
The cables wind and unwind as the door moves, distributing the weight and balancing the door’s motion. Without these cables, the door would be extremely difficult to operate and could become a significant safety hazard.
Types of Garage Door Cables
There are several types of garage door cables, each serving a specific purpose within the system. Understanding the different types can help you recognize issues and understand the repair process better.
Lift Cables
Lift cables are the most common type found in garage door systems. These cables are attached to the bottom corners of the door and run through a series of pulleys and drums. They work directly with the torsion springs, winding and unwinding to lift and lower the door. Lift cables are essential for maintaining the balance and smooth operation of the garage door.
Retaining Cables
Retaining cables, also known as safety cables, are typically found in extension spring systems. These cables run through the extension springs and are anchored to the door track. In the event of a spring breaking, retaining cables prevent the spring from flying off, reducing the risk of injury or damage. While they do not play a direct role in lifting the door, retaining cables are crucial for the overall safety of the system.
Emergency Release Cables
Emergency release cables are a vital safety feature in modern garage door systems. These cables are connected to the garage door opener’s trolley and allow you to manually open the door in case of a power outage or malfunction. Pulling the emergency release cable disengages the opener from the door, enabling you to lift the door manually.
The Function of Garage Door Cables
Garage door cables perform several essential functions that ensure the safe and efficient operation of the door. These functions include:
Weight Distribution
Garage doors can weigh several hundred pounds, and lifting this weight manually would be incredibly challenging. Garage door cables distribute the weight evenly, working with the springs to make the door easy to lift and lower. This distribution prevents undue strain on the opener and other components.
Balance and Stability
Properly functioning cables maintain the balance and stability of the garage door. When a cable becomes worn or breaks, the door can become unbalanced, leading to uneven operation and increased wear on other parts of the system. Balanced cables ensure the door moves smoothly along its tracks.
Safety and Prevention
Garage door cables play a crucial role in the safety of the system. Retaining cables, in particular, prevent extension springs from causing injury or damage if they break. Lift cables ensure the door remains securely attached to the lifting mechanism, reducing the risk of the door falling unexpectedly.
Common Issues with Garage Door Cables
Like any mechanical component, garage door cables can experience wear and tear over time. Identifying common issues can help you address problems before they become serious.
Fraying and Wear
Over time, garage door cables can become frayed due to constant movement and tension. Fraying weakens the cables, making them more likely to snap. Regular inspection of the cables for signs of wear and fraying is essential for maintaining the system’s integrity.
Rust and Corrosion
Exposure to moisture can cause garage door cables to rust and corrode. Rust weakens the cables, reducing their strength and increasing the risk of breakage. Lubricating the cables with a high-quality garage door lubricant can help prevent rust and extend their lifespan.
Misalignment and Tangling
Cables can become misaligned or tangled if the door is not operating smoothly. This issue can cause the door to become stuck or operate unevenly. Ensuring the cables are properly aligned and tensioned can prevent these problems.
Breakage
A broken cable is a serious issue that can render the garage door inoperable. When a cable snaps, the door can become unbalanced and difficult to move. It is crucial to address a broken cable immediately to prevent further damage and ensure safety.
Garage Door Cable Repairs
Repairing or replacing garage door cables is not a DIY task. The high tension in these cables makes them dangerous to handle without proper tools and expertise. Professional garage door technicians are trained to safely repair and replace cables, ensuring the system operates correctly.
Inspection and Diagnosis
When you call a professional for garage door cable repair, they will start by conducting a thorough inspection of the entire system. This inspection helps identify the root cause of the issue and any other components that may need attention. The technician will examine the cables for signs of wear, fraying, rust, and alignment problems.
Cable Replacement
If the cables are damaged or worn, the technician will carefully remove the old cables and install new ones. This process involves disconnecting the cables from the door and lifting mechanism, ensuring the door is securely supported during the repair. The new cables are then threaded through the pulleys and drums, and properly tensioned to maintain balance and stability.
Adjustments and Testing
After replacing the cables, the technician will make any necessary adjustments to ensure the door operates smoothly. This step includes checking the tension of the cables and springs, aligning the tracks, and lubricating moving parts. The technician will then test the door to ensure it opens and closes correctly, making any final adjustments as needed.
